PhilNITS : The new JITSE
THE JAPANESE IT Standard Examination Philippine Foundation Inc (JITSE Philippines) has changed its corporate name to the Philippine National IT Standards Foundation (PhilNITS) Inc.
Maricor Akol, president of PhilNITS, said the change in the corporate name is intended to correct the misconception that the IT standard exams being implemented are only for the Japanese market.
PhilNITS is a non-stock, non-profit, non-government organization that is implementing an internationally recognized certification program from the Japan Information Technology Engineers Examination Center (JITEC) of the Ministry of Economic, Trade and Industry (METI) of Japan without necesarrily limiting the use only for the Japanese market.
